To add a little to what the others said, I would transfer your Wii content to your Wii U first, before downloading Paper Mario. I'm not sure what happens if you do it before, but when you do the transfer, your old Wii shop account gets transferred to the Wii U. You might as well do that first before redeeming the code on your Wii U - just to be sure you have everything on the one account.
You could also probably redeem it on the Wii first, then do the trasfer of everything. But you might as well do it afterwards once you've verified the transfer worked OK (mine went flawlessly once I got the USB network adapter. I never could do much of anything over WiFi with either the Wii or Wii U).
